Photoshop will also automatically adjust the colors for you if you would like. If you are unhappy with your changes when adjusting the colors, you can easily revert to the default colors by selecting the “ Reset to adjustment defaults” icon next to the toggle icon. To view the changes you have made to the adjustment layer, hold in the toggle icon at the bottom of the Properties panel or hold in “ \”. Moving the “ Blues” color down to -41 makes the child’s shirt a darker shade. Slide a color to the right to make it lighter on the image or to the left to make it darker. The Properties panel will also appear above the Layers panel with options to adjust the luminance of different color ranges.Īdjusting the colors in the Properties panel will change the luminance of the image by making certain areas darker or lighter. Once the new adjustment layer has been created the image will now be in black and white. You can also use the adjustment layer icon at the bottom of the Layers panel and select “Black & White…” to create the new adjustment layer. This will create a new layer in the Layers panel. To create a black and white adjustment layer, navigate to the Adjustments panel and select the “ Black & White” icon. You can also manipulate the image to only have certain parts in black and white. This method allows you to control the contrast of the black and white layer. The best way to make an entire layer black and white is to create a new adjustment layer that converts the image to black and white.
